When reporter Peter Sommers returns to his grandparents' farm in the wake of their death, he uncovers a horrifying mystery that challenges everything he knows about his family, his sanity and reality itself.
1997
2007
2004
1992
1964
2006
2003
1994
1983
1998
1991
1990
1987
2000
2005
1961